anharmonic
adjEtymology
From an- + harmonic.
- derived from ἁρμονικός
- derived from harmonicus
Definitions
Not harmonic. Inharmonic.
Exhibiting anharmonicity
- An anharmonic oscillator is a perturbed version of a harmonic oscillator.

Describing the section of a line by four points, A, B, C, D, when their mutual distances are such that AB divided by CB is not equal to AD divided by CD.
